About the role

  • Support, manage, and advise on legal aspects of real estate and site control matters for NSE’s solar projects throughout development, financing, and operations.
  • Report to the Chief Legal Administrative Officer (and may report to interim managers).
  • Remote position with travel expected 2 – 3 times per year.
  • Manage completion of real estate requirements to meet project milestones within company’s goals.
  • Manage due diligence of project sites: review title searches, surveys, site control agreements, environmental assessments, land use and zoning materials; oversee title review and curative work.
  • Coordinate with third-parties: other NSE departments, external legal counsel, project developers, landowners, project lenders and investors, title companies and surveyors.
  • Prepare and review legal documents: leases, options, purchase agreements, easements, and amendments to secure site control for development, construction and financing of projects.
  • Identify and evaluate risks: assess real estate and site control risks, evaluate magnitude, and propose options for resolution; communicate risks clearly to non-attorneys.
  • Coordinate deliverables for project acquisitions and financings: title curative matters, lenders’ title policies, title endorsements, and estoppels for debt and tax equity financings.
  • Miscellaneous real estate tasks for the projects as assigned.
